(formerly Under Control Robotics / UCR) is an American robotics startup headquartered in Sunnyvale, California, founded in 2024 by a team of engineers from companies and institutions including Apple, SpaceX, NASA, and Caltech. The co-founders are Wei Ding (CEO), Wen-Loong (Wenlong) Ma (CTO), Christopher McQuin, and Wenda Wang. On March 3, 2026, the company announced its exit from stealth mode and the delivery of its first robots to a Fortune Global 500 customer, just 18 months after launch. The company's flagship product — the Moby humanoid robot — supports a payload of up to 27 kg (60 lbs), offers approximately 5 hours of battery autonomy, and is powered by NVIDIA Jetson Orin. The technology platform is built on a proprietary hardware-software stack combining AI-driven whole-body control with end-to-end autonomy. The robots can learn new industrial skills within hours through natural language instructions, demonstrations, and gestures. Noble Machines leverages NVIDIA Isaac Sim and Newton (a physics engine based on NVIDIA Warp and OpenUSD) for digital twin creation and to shorten the sim-to-real pipeline. The company partners with ADLINK (edge computing), Schaeffler (actuators), and Solomon (factory integrations). Target sectors include industrial manufacturing, construction, logistics, energy, and semiconductors.
